| Iam very concerned,I have a 10 week old Husky pup who is just adorable but she is not nice to our 8 month old submissive Border Collie.She bites her constantly in the neck and face making her cry out.I really want to keep this puppy but need help.She is mildly aggressive with us but mostly dog aggressive.Can anyone suggest help for us.Thanks |

| This is not aggression. This is rough puppy play. In this case. I'd recommend a time out, and separating the puppy from the older puppy until the puppy calms down. |

| I do not have a 2 dog home, however, I will point out that at 10 weeks old this is probably not aggressive behavior, but really just husky puppy behavior. Husky puppies are very mouthy. May I ask how old was your husky when you brought her home? If she was under 8 weeks old, than she was not properly socialized with her siblings, and looks to your other puppy as a litter mate. |

| This is not aggressive - it is how husky pups play. Having "babysat" my son's husky mix, I know how constant and interminable husky pups can play...and annoy, their elders. If your older dog won't correct the pup, then its up to you to separate the two when it is too much for her. As for mouthing humans - there is a lot on here about modifying this behavior (again, it is NOT aggressive - husky pups use their mouths like we do our hands - it is how they play). Basically, it is all about substituting appropriate "mouth" things when the mouth you. I've gotten Archer, the pup, now a year old, where, when he starts to mouth my work gloves outside, I tell him to sit, then I give him what is looking for...I rub him, "cuff" him in play, maybe throw a toy or get a tuggy (I make mine out of strips of old sweatpant legs tied in knots).
